    Student Reviews and Testimonials

    Okay, so what do other students have to say about Lesson Plus Driving School? Reviews and testimonials are incredibly valuable. They give you a real, unfiltered look at the school. You can often find these reviews on their website, social media pages, and review sites like Google Reviews or Yelp. Look for common themes in the reviews. Are most people happy with the instructors? Do they find the lessons effective? Are the cars well-maintained? This is important because it'll help you spot the areas where the school excels and where it might need improvement. Pay attention to the specific things people mention. Did the instructor go the extra mile to help them pass their test? Was the scheduling convenient? Did they feel safe and comfortable during their lessons? These details can provide valuable insights into the school's strengths and weaknesses. Also, keep an eye out for any red flags. Do you see a lot of complaints about the same issues? Are there safety concerns? Take these issues seriously and consider how they might affect your experience. When reading reviews, try to get a well-rounded perspective. Don't just focus on the positive reviews. Look at the negative ones too. This can give you a more realistic picture of what to expect. Think about whether the reviews align with your own expectations. If you're looking for a patient instructor who caters to nervous drivers, make sure the reviews reflect this. Student reviews are a great resource and give you a more comprehensive insight into the overall experience. By carefully reviewing and evaluating the feedback, you can get a good feel for the driving school's reputation and make an informed decision.

    Tips for Choosing a Driving School

    Okay, so you're ready to pick a driving school! Here are a few tips to help you make the right choice. First, check for accreditation and licensing. Make sure the school is properly licensed and accredited by your local authorities. This ensures they meet certain standards of quality and safety. Consider the instructor's experience and qualifications. Look for instructors with experience, good reviews, and certifications. A good instructor can make all the difference in your learning experience. Check out the school's curriculum. Does it cover all the necessary topics? Does it include both classroom and behind-the-wheel instruction? Ensure it is a comprehensive curriculum that covers all the basics. Look at the cars and facilities. Are the cars well-maintained and safe? Does the school have a comfortable and conducive learning environment? The better the car, the better it is for you! Read student reviews and testimonials to get an idea of other students' experiences. This is important to know if the experience is worth your time. Check the school's pricing and packages. Compare the pricing and packages offered by different schools. Make sure it fits your budget and needs. Think about location and convenience. Choose a school that's located close to you and offers convenient scheduling options. Location, location, location. Driving schools need to be in a good area! Most importantly, trust your gut. If something doesn't feel right, it's okay to look for another school. Choosing a driving school is a big decision, so take your time and do your research. By following these tips, you can find a driving school that meets your needs and helps you become a safe and confident driver.
